use crate::config::{PROBE_INTERVAL_MS, PROBE_TIMEOUT_MS, TARGETS, TARGET_PORT};
use crate::monitor::{PingResult, ProbeRound};
use chrono::Utc;
use std::time::Duration;
use tokio::net::TcpStream;
use tokio::sync::mpsc;
use tokio::time::{timeout, Instant};
async fn probe_target(target: &str, port: u16) -> PingResult {
let start = Instant::now();
let addr = format!("{}:{}", target, port);
let result = timeout(
Duration::from_millis(PROBE_TIMEOUT_MS),
TcpStream::connect(&addr),
)
.await;
let elapsed = start.elapsed();
let latency_ms = elapsed.as_secs_f64() * 1000.0;
let success = result.is_ok() && result.unwrap().is_ok();
PingResult {
target: target.to_string(),
success,
latency_ms: if success { Some(latency_ms) } else { None },
timestamp: Utc::now(),
}
}
async fn probe_all_targets() -> ProbeRound {
let mut tasks = Vec::new();
for &target in TARGETS.iter() {
let task = tokio::spawn(probe_target(target, TARGET_PORT));
tasks.push(task);
}
let mut results = Vec::new();
for task in tasks {
if let Ok(result) = task.await {
results.push(result);
}
}
ProbeRound {
results,
timestamp: Utc::now(),
}
}
pub async fn run_probe_loop(tx: mpsc::Sender<ProbeRound>) {
let mut interval = tokio::time::interval(Duration::from_millis(PROBE_INTERVAL_MS));
loop {
interval.tick().await;
let round = probe_all_targets().await;
if tx.send(round).await.is_err() {
break;
}
}
}
